1968 Alfa Romeo 1750 vs. 2008 Geely CK
To start off, 2008 Geely CK is newer by 40 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1968 Alfa Romeo 1750.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1968 Alfa Romeo 1750 would be higher. At 1,779 cc (4 cylinders), 1968 Alfa Romeo 1750 is equipped with a bigger engine.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1968 Alfa Romeo 1750 weights approximately 40 kg more than 2008 Geely CK.
Because 1968 Alfa Romeo 1750 is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1968 Alfa Romeo 1750.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2008 Geely CK,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1968 Alfa Romeo 1750 (168 Nm @ 4400 RPM) has 40 more torque (in Nm) than 2008 Geely CK. (128 Nm @ 3400 RPM). This means 1968 Alfa Romeo 1750 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2008 Geely CK.
Compare all specifications:
1968 Alfa Romeo 1750 | 2008 Geely CK | |
Make | Alfa Romeo | Geely |
Model | 1750 | CK |
Year Released | 1968 | 2008 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1779 cc | 1498 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 2 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 120 HP | 0 HP |
Torque | 168 Nm | 128 Nm |
Torque RPM | 4400 RPM | 3400 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 80 mm | 78.7 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 88.5 mm | 77 mm |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Rear | Front |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 4 doors | 4 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 1080 kg | 1040 kg |
Wheelbase Size | 2580 mm | 2440 mm |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 45 L | 45 L |
